Horace and Juvenal were prominent Roman poets from the 1st century BCE and 1st century CE, respectively. Horace is best known for his lyrical poetry, particularly his Odes and Satires, which explore themes of love, philosophy, and the human experience. Juvenal, on the other hand, is renowned for his biting satirical verses that critique Roman society, politics, and moral decay. Together, they provide valuable insights into the culture and values of ancient Rome.
